Derided Computer Plan Clicks With Maine Students

from the took-them-long-enough dept

When Maine’s governor first announced his plans to give every student in the state a laptop computer, people told him he was crazy. Now, however, that the plan is underway it seems that many of the sketpics have changed their minds. The students love the computers, and parents feel that their children are receiving a better educational experience. While I’m sure not everyone is thrilled with the program, it certainly sounds like it was well planned, and so far, has turned out much better than expected. What will be interesting is to see how it works over time, and if other states begin to offer similar plans.
